Capacitors are commonly used components in power supply design, mainly for storing charges, stabilizing voltage, filtering, and blocking DC. The working principle can be explained by a simple capacitance formula: a capacitor stores charge between two plates, and its capacitance depends on the area, dielectric constant, and spacing between the plates. When a capacitor is connected to a power source, it absorbs charge and stores it in the electric field between the two plates, resulting in a voltage difference. Choosing the appropriate capacitor is crucial in various power supply designs. Here are some correct selection rules for capacitors:

1. Capacitor type: Select the appropriate type of capacitor according to the requirements of the power circuit, such as DCP022405P aluminum electrolytic capacitor, solid electrolytic capacitor, ceramic capacitor, etc.

2. Capacitance value: Select the appropriate capacitance value based on the power demand and frequency characteristics of the power supply, usually requiring capacitance calculation or simulation to determine the optimal value.

3. Voltage capacity: The rated voltage of the capacitor must be greater than the maximum operating voltage in the circuit, and there should be a certain safety margin to avoid damage from overvoltage of the capacitor.

5. Temperature characteristics: Select capacitors with good temperature characteristics based on the temperature variation range of the power supply working environment.

6. Frequency characteristics: For high-frequency power supplies, select capacitors with good high-frequency characteristics to ensure that they can still operate normally at high frequencies.

In summary, the correct selection of capacitors is crucial for power supply design. It is necessary to comprehensively consider factors such as the type, value, rated voltage, size, temperature, and frequency characteristics of capacitors to ensure the stable and reliable operation of the power supply system.  diode
